## Step 4: Configure the restock planner service

RestockPilot schedules vending-machine refills for all Kellner Markets locations. The planner worker authenticates against the Harvix routing API before pulling machine inventory snapshots, so the env file must be in place before first boot. Permissions on the file should be 600 and owned by the service account. Review the values below before deployment. Add the following line to /etc/restockpilot/prod.env to set the routing API credential:

sealed setting: ARCHIVE_KEY3=bbe

Handing off the ScanPoint barcode integration to you before I rotate off. Decoder runs behind the Quillbox gateway; GS1 parsing is done, Code 128 still flaky on low-res scans. Tests pass except the damaged-label suite. Don't touch the retry wrapper — it papers over a firmware quirk. The integration reads these configuration values at startup.

service settings:
WENATH_LOG_LEVEL=debug
WENATH_METRICS_HOST=metrics.wenath.norvalabs.internal
WENATH_POOL_SIZE=16

Subject: Handover — Fleetwise dispatch release duties. Welcome aboard. Main thing this cycle: the driver-assignment heuristic in Fleetwise v12 now weights proximity over idle time, so expect spiky reassignments in low-density zones; Marla's dashboard tracks it. Releases go out Tuesdays after the Penhallow depot sync. Cut the tag, run the assignment replay suite, and sign the release bundle with the key below.

deploy key for kajof-fajop: bky6_gDHw9Q

To department heads, from outgoing director Mara Fenwick to incoming director Tomas Ilde.

Status: Brellan Marine's joint venture proposal is at draft-agreement stage. Equity split agreed at 55/45 in our favour; governance terms still open, notably veto rights on capex above threshold. Legal review due next week. Key contacts and negotiation history are in the shared file. Do not commit to timelines with Brellan until Tomas has reviewed. The confidential position we intend to hold is stated below.

internal memo for kawip-hadug: Headcount on the Wenwyn team goes from 7 to 140 by the end of January. Gross margin on Wenwyn came in at 20 percent against a plan of 15 percent.